Ghana has several business registration systems. Company registration is done by the Registrar General’s Department,[1] but this duty will be transferred to the new Office of the Registrar of Companies under the terms of the Companies Act, 2018.[2] Both resident Ghanaian companies and branches of foreign companies are required to register and obtain a permit before operating in Ghana.[3] In 2008-2009 procedures were simplified and the target is now to complete registration within one day.[4]
